Provides technical support and extended role clinical duties on wards and in the pharmacy relating to optimal use of medicines. Area of work will be determined by service needs and the post holder will need to be proficient to work in all areas.
The role involves supply of medicines via various routes supporting assessment of patients’ medicines needs and resolution of physical and clinical issues relating to medicines.
Post holders are required to have relevant GPhC accreditation (NVQ2 in Pharmacy Services) or equivalent.

The Hillingdon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ust is the only acute hospital in the London Borough of Hillingdon and offers a wide range of services, including accident and emergency, inpatient care, day surgery, outpatient clinics, and maternity services.
